Genauer gesagt möchte ich in einer Spalte nach dem Wert #NV suchen und diesen löschen, bis das Tabellenblatt "bereinigt" ist. Vielen Dank
Sub FehlerLoeschen()
'Zellen mit Fehlerwert #NV finden und Zellinhalt löschen
Dim wks As Worksheet, Zelle As Range, Bereich As Range, Spalte
Set wks = ActiveSheet
Spalte = 3 'Spalte C
With wks
Set Bereich = .Range(.Cells(1, Spalte), .Cells(.Rows.Count, Spalte).End(xlUp))
For Each Zelle In Bereich
If Application.WorksheetFunction.IsNA(Zelle.Value) Then
Zelle.ClearContents
End If
Next
End With
End Sub
Sub Fehler_weg()
'Fehler, verursacht durch Formel:
Range("A:A").Cells.SpecialCells(xlCellTypeFormulas, 16).ClearContents
'Fehler, verursacht durch Eingabe in Zelle:
'Range("A:A").Cells.SpecialCells(xlCellTypeConstants, 16).ClearContents
End Sub
GrüßeDie erweiterte Suchfunktion hilft dir, gezielt die besten Antworten zu finden
Suche nach den besten AntwortenEntdecke unsere meistgeklickten Beiträge in der Google Suche
Top 100 Threads jetzt ansehen